Weis Markets Launches Holiday Edition Of Fight Hunger Campaign

Weis Markets logo fight hunger campaign

Due to increased need for holiday donations to local food banks, Weis Markets has launched a special holiday edition of its Fight Hunger campaign.

Through the end of the year, customers will have the option of rounding up their order or purchasing a $1, $3, $5 or $10 voucher at checkout to help support families in need in their community.  

“We’re launching our Fight Hunger program for the second time this year due to the tremendous increase in food bank demand throughout our markets in seven states,” said Ron Bonacci, Weis Markets VP of advertising and marketing. “This is a difficult and challenging time for many families in the communities we serve. We’re grateful to our customers and associates for their support of our program and look to finish strong in the coming weeks.” 

Earlier in 2020, Weis Markets and its associates worked with customers to generate more than $1.3 million in combined customer and corporate donations for local food banks. Since 2008, the Sunbury, Pennsylvania-based company has raised more than $3.8 million through the Fight Hunger Campaign and has supplemented customers’ generosity with company donations.

Weis Markets’ Fight Hunger Campaign benefits regional food banks throughout its seven-state market area, including:

  • The Second Harvest Food Bank of the Lehigh Valley and Northeast Pennsylvania;
  • The Central Pennsylvania Food Bank (Harrisburg and Williamsport, Pennsylvania);
  • Helping Harvest (Reading, Pennsylvania);
  • The Maryland Food Bank;
  • The Commission on Economic Opportunity/The Weinberg Northeast Regional Food Bank (Wilkes-Barre/Scranton, Pennsylvania);
  • Greater Berks Food Bank (Reading, Pennsylvania);
  • Philabundance (Montgomery and Bucks counties, Pennsylvania);
  • Community Hunger Outreach Warehouse (CHOW)/Broome County Council of Churches;
  • Food Bank of the Southern Tier (Elmira, New York); 
  • Food Bank Network of Somerset County;
  • Community Food Bank of New Jersey;
  • Fredericksburg Regional Food Bank (Virginia); and
  • Food Bank of Delaware; and Mountaineer Food Bank (West Virginia).
